Description
Tributyltin methoxide (CAS No. 1067-52-3) is a highly specialized organotin compound with the molecular formula C13H30OSn. This chemical is widely utilized in advanced research and industrial applications due to its unique reactivity as a methoxide derivative of tributyltin. It is available in high purity (97%) and is commonly employed as a catalyst or reagent in organic synthesis, polymerization processes, and material science applications. Its stability under controlled conditions makes it a preferred choice for precision chemical reactions. Proper handling and storage under inert atmospheres are recommended to maintain its integrity.
Properties
- CAS Number: 1067-52-3
- Complexity: 115
- IUPAC Name: tributyl(methoxy)stannane
- InChI: InChI=1S/3C4H9.CH3O.Sn/c3*1-3-4-2;1-2;/h3*1,3-4H2,2H3;1H3;/q;;;-1;+1
- InChI Key: KJGLZJQPMKQFIK-UHFFFAOYSA-N
- Exact Mass: 322.131868
- Molecular Formula: C13H30OSn
- Molecular Weight: 321.09
- SMILES: CCCC[Sn](CCCC)(CCCC)OC
- Topological: 9.2
- Monoisotopic Mass: 322.131868

Tributyltin methoxide is primarily used as a catalyst in esterification and transesterification reactions. It also serves as a key reagent in the synthesis of organotin polymers and stabilizers for PVC. Researchers leverage its reactivity in cross-coupling reactions and as a precursor for other tin-based compounds. Its applications extend to specialized coatings and antifouling agents in marine environments.
Safety and Hazards
GHS Hazard Statements
- H301 (100%): Toxic if swallowed [Danger Acute toxicity, oral]
- H312 (97.8%): Harmful in contact with skin [Warning Acute toxicity, dermal]
- H315 (100%): Causes skin irritation [Warning Skin corrosion/irritation]
- H319 (100%): Causes serious eye irritation [Warning Serious eye damage/eye irritation]
- H372 (100%): Causes damage to organs through prolonged or repeated exposure [Danger Specific target organ toxicity, repeated exposure]
- H400 (100%): Very toxic to aquatic life [Warning Hazardous to the aquatic environment, acute hazard]
- H410 (97.8%): Very to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ects [Warning Hazardous to the aquatic environment, long-term hazard]
